Summary: | The invention provides a method for preparation of one-dimensional cobalt oxalate by rapid precipitation. The method has the excellent characteristics of high efficiency, rapidity, simplicity and thelike in material preparation, overcomes the huge challenge of regulating a one-dimensional nano-material caused by quick crystallization of precipitation reaction, the one-dimensional nano-material CoC2O4 is prepared, and sodium binoxalate (NaHC2O4) is adopted as the precipitant to precipitate the target material quickly. NaHC2O4 has low dissociation coefficient, and can slowly release C2O4<2-> ions to balance the growth speed and diffusion speed of the material, so that the material can grow in a one-dimensional direction in the growth process. The invention provides a morphology and phase regulation method of a CoC2O4 nanorod with excellent performance.
